Zach Anderson 7730809f36 Revert "Reintroducing MallocHooks changes with fix for infinite loop in MallocHooks on Platform::Exit."
This reverts commit 7bf5d87017.

The lock introduced by this change in MallocHooksState is held across
a fork(), which causes deadlock in the child when execvpe() fails and
tries to acquire the lock when freeing memory.

Zachary Anderson e933f28a18 Remove some uses of STL map.
This CL removes the use of STL map from freelist.cc by adding
MallocDirectChainedHashMap in hash_map.h and adding an iterator for
BaseDirectChainedHashMap there.

It also removes a use of STL map from hash_table.h that was dead code.

vegorov@google.com 55c9c6c444 Allow bound check elimination to eliminate checks when both array length and index boundaries are expressed through the same symbol.
For example:

var list = new List(n);
for (var i = 0; i < n; i++) list[i];

fschneider@google.com 323e06222e Reland "Add a simple dominator based redundancy elimination" and fix a register allocation bug.
Original CL: http://codereview.chromium.org/10872035/

It enables elimination of redundant expressions across
basic blocks.

Currently used for smi checks and class checks, but will
be extended to other expressions in a separate CL.


Additionally, this fixes a bug in the register allocator where
a blocked register was illegally assigned to an unallocated live range.

It also fixes a Mac compiler issue with the constructor of
DirectChainedHashMap.

fschneider@google.com 253c3f8499 Implement class id checks as a separate instruction and add a local CSE optimization pass.
This CL contains:
A new CheckClassComp instruction. Currently it is used only for instance loads:
(LoadInstanceFieldComp)

A pass LocalCSE that performs block-local common subexpression elimination. To identify
redundant expressions I use a hash map per basic block. Computations that do not have
side effects can participate in CSE. For now, I only enabled it for CheckClass.
Any computation that participates in CSE must implement the AttributesEqual function.


Other smaller fixes:

Places where we can pass the correct initial size for GrowableArrays
that have a known size. We should consider having a FixedLengthArray for this purpose.

Made the accessors ic_data() and set_ic_data() use a const ICData*.
